Hey plugin folks — the nightly search reindex on Quillstone has been failing since Tuesday because the service credentials expired. If your plugin hooks into the reindex pipeline, you've probably seen empty result sets. We've minted fresh credentials and the job should catch up tonight. Update your local configs before the next run. The new key for the indexing service is below.

gateway credential: kto3_qfe

**Ticket: Document canary deploy gating rules for Pondwright services**

New team members keep asking how canary promotion works, so this ticket covers writing the gating rules into the onboarding guide. In short: canaries run at 5% traffic for 30 minutes, error rate must stay below 0.5%, and p99 latency may not regress more than 10% against baseline. Any manual override requires a logged justification. Before this documentation is merged and the ticket closed, it needs a formal sign-off, which should come from the person named below.

named custodian: Oliath Ralax

## Deployment

Foundrybelt build agents must keep their clocks within a tight tolerance; artifact signing rejects timestamps that drift more than a few seconds from the coordinator. Support should verify that every agent syncs against the internal Chronarch time service before investigating signature failures, since skew is the most common root cause. After confirming synchronization, validate that each agent's deployment settings match the values below:

service settings:
PRAIX_LOG_LEVEL=error
PRAIX_METRICS_HOST=metrics.praix.qorvelcorp.corp
PRAIX_POOL_SIZE=16

# Farewheel Pricing Experiment — Env Vars

For the weekly sync: the ticket-pricing experiment on Farewheel reads PRICE_EXP_COHORT and PRICE_EXP_RATE at boot. Flip cohorts only between sales windows. Metrics flush to the Oatbin dashboard every five minutes. The experiment service authenticates to the pricing ledger with a secret, which is set on the line below.

sealed setting: ARCHIVE_KEY3=8d0